Airbnb
UX Redesign
This is a personal Airbnb UX redesign project that aims to empower groups of friends to organize their trips collectively within the current Airbnb App
At A Glance
My Role
Researcher
UX designer
UI designer
Approach
Interview, User Story, Competitive Analysis, User Flow, Low-fi prototype
Context
personal project
2 weeks
Inspiration
My trip to turkey inspired this project with my friends, and the overall experience was wonderful, but there are still some problems that annoyed me every now and then.
We need to constantly jump between apps(Airbnb, Instagram, and Google) to plan our trip together, causing important links to get lost and storing information on different platforms. Since one person in the group made all the bookings, he had basically most of the detailed information about the reservations, I had to ask him frequently about when and where we will go all the time. lastly group trip involves complicated spending that is hard to follow and track.
With these problems in mind, I wonder if they happen to me or if they are universal experiences/pain points for the majority of users and if there’s a universal need for a group trip planning function within the Airbnb app
Hypothesis
Separated
Tools
hopping between different apps is inconvenient
Information
Asymmetry
only one person has the access of information of reservations
Budget & Bill Management
complicated spending that is hard to follow and track
🧐
.png)
Before any design...
before I get too excited about designing the new solutions, understanding what the current design is like and deconstructing the existing functions and user flows becomes the priority.
Search
Wishlist
-
Search for stays and experiences based on the specific location, dates, number, and type of guests
-
Filter the items shown on the page
-
Flexible search without information of destinations/ dates/ guests
-
Recent searches store information about user's past searches and link to result page
-
add an item to an existing wishlist
-
a pop-up notification shows the item is added
-
create a new wishlist and name it while adding an item
-
Share the wishlist for view/edit
Trip
-
browse details of upcoming trips/past reservations
-
An entry of the search function while there’s no reservation
🔎
❤️
🧳
How do users plan their trips?
In order to find out if my hypothesis is right (or wrong?) I began my user research with in-person interviews with 5 people and talked about how they plan their group trips and what their problems are
figuring out how users plan their trips and what tools they use in their own way is a good method to understand what function is needed and expected for a group trip.

Miro
-
co-editing
-
chat
-
itinerary timeline & activities mapping
-
budget
-
notes
-
itinerary timeline & activities
-
only for view




Google Sheet
-
co-editing
-
itinerary timeline & activities
-
locations mapping
-
budget calculation
-
notes


Notepad
-
itinerary timeline & activities
-
locations mapping
-
only for view


Key Insights
01
🧑🤝🧑👫👭
Group Dynamic and roles
There's a typical group dynamic involving two main roles which are leaders and followers. leaders tend to plan the trip proactively while followers follows what the leaders ask them to do
the leaders usually make the majority of the reservation and payments, they become the only access to the information of reservations causing information asymmetry
02
Similar process
🔨
The process of the group trip planning is highly similar:
1. talk about everyone's preferences (places to visit, stays, activities, and budget)
2. collect a list of possible stays and activities
3. the leader makes a draft of the itinerary and everyone discusses the itinerary
4. if there's a major difference of opinions, vote and decide
5. the leader refines the itinerary, makes the reservations and everyone involved splits the bill
6. plan for more activities based on the budget and the remaining money

03
📱
Platform hopping
Group planning involves different apps (Messaging app, Airbnb, Spreadsheet, calculator, and note apps ). This makes discussions hard to follow and the itinerary not easily accessible. Travelers prefer to only use mobile phones once on route and access information while at the airport, car rental company, or hotel
.png)
04
Budget & spending
💰
when going on a trip longer than a week, users will set a budget for the whole trip for different categories like transport, accommodation, and food...
the bill splitting is tricky, inconvenient, and time-consuming, users need to note down all those group payments involve only some of the members, to later split the bill
Persona
Young people who use Airbnb and like to go on short trips with a small group of friends
.png)
Lisa
22-year old, student, London
#Leader
She is the leader of the trip planning and thus dedicated and involved in every stage
-
Gather everyone’s opinions(budget, type of stay, amenities)
-
Search for information on stays events and transport
-
Collect most of the possible stays, experiences, and attractions
-
Take some notes for each item
-
Design itinerary draft
-
Organize discussion and refine the itinerary
-
Make reservations and split costs
Needs
-
organized
-
proactive
Attributes
-
Drive the group to make decisions
-
Make sure the plan works for everyone
-
Track the spending and the money members owe each other
Goals
.png)
James
23-year old, junior software engineer, London
#Follower
He doesn’t necessarily need to get involved in every stage but attend key events as a part of group decisions
Needs
-
Collect possible stays, activities, and attractions
-
Join the discussion and give opinions
-
Vote for options if there’s a major difference
-
Look at itinerary details
-
Note down their spending and transfer money
-
laid back
-
casual
Attributes
Goals
-
Go to places and do things he likes
-
Don't need to worry about reservations and transport
-
Travel within the budget
User Needs
01
Easy communication
communication tools for sharing wishlists, discussions, and decisions on the planning
02
Symmetric information access
everyone has the access to information on the wishlist listings, itinerary details, budget, and messages from hosts
03
Budget & bill management
-
set budget for different categories
-
view the left budget
-
split the bill after the bookings are made
04
Seamless experience
discuss and plan their trip within fewer apps as possible instead of platform-hopping
User Story
To break users needs down to specific actions
When i'm...
I want to...
so i can...
Situation
motivation
expectation
searching for and collecting list of stays and things to do
viewing the collection of listings
viewing the collection of listings
designing the itinerary
designing the itinerary
there's major conflict/too many options
planning for more activities
making the reservation
after making reservations
see all of the listings in one place
know others preferences
know how others opinions and attitude towards the listings
know how others' opinions and attitudes towards the itinerary
see the locations of activities and tourists attractions
discuss and vote
view the budget and the remaining money
note down who's involved in the payment
inform others to split the bill
view them more efficiently all at once instead of looking for it from chat history
find places that suit everyone's needs
focus on the popular ones
refine the itinerary based on everyone's opinions
figure out the route and the transportation
make decision that satisfy most of the members
select affordable activities that match our budget
track who owes me money and how much
get money back
How might we
empower groups of friends to organize their trips collectively within the current Airbnb App?
Designing For Solutions
Integration
Design a feature as the integration of a communication app, calculator app, notepad, and Airbnb wishlist, It gives users a better seamless flow of the app

Create a group trip
create a group trip storing information of locations, group members, and dates
Search
search for stays and experiences based on the locations, group members, and dates of the group trip
Shared Wishlist
explore stays and experiences, then simply shared them on the wishlist accessible to everyone
leave a comment on the listings or give a like to show their attitude
Easy communication
have a discussion on anything within the group chat and create a poll while there're too many good options
Shared itinerary
design a shared and visualized itinerary by adding stays, experiences, and transportation
simply add plans from reservations of Airbnb
Shared budget
set the shared budget according to different categories
a quick option to split the bill while making a reservation
Split the bill
add expenses to the group budget , choose from past orders then split the bill with chosen people
all bill splits will be tracked and made into a debt summary where users and view who owe them and how much